The KTM 790 Duke 2018 and the Kawasaki Z650 2017 are both naked bikes with similar engine types, fuel injection systems, and liquid cooling. However, there are several differences between the two models.
In terms of power, the KTM 790 Duke 2018 has a more powerful engine with 105 HP compared to the Kawasaki Z650 2017's 68.2 HP. This means that the KTM offers a higher level of acceleration and performance.
Both bikes have a two-cylinder engine, but the KTM has a larger displacement of 799 ccm compared to the Kawasaki's 649 ccm. This larger displacement contributes to the KTM's higher power output.
In terms of suspension, both bikes have a telescopic front fork and a monoshock rear suspension with pre-load adjustment. However, the KTM's front fork is a upside-down telescopic fork, which is typically found on higher-end sport bikes and offers better performance and handling.

The chassis of the KTM 790 Duke 2018 is made of chromium-molybdenum, which is a high-strength steel alloy that provides a lightweight and rigid frame. On the other hand, the Kawasaki Z650 2017 has a steel frame. The KTM's frame material is more advanced and contributes to its sportier handling characteristics.
Both bikes have dual disc front brakes with a diameter of 300 mm. However, the KTM's front brakes have four pistons and use radial technology, which provides better braking performance compared to the Kawasaki's dual piston front brakes with petal technology.
In terms of advanced rider assistance systems, the KTM 790 Duke 2018 offers ABS, riding modes, and traction control. The Kawasaki Z650 2017 only has ABS.
In terms of dimensions, the KTM has a wider front tire (120 mm) compared to the Kawasaki's 120 mm front tire. The KTM also has a wider rear tire (180 mm) compared to the Kawasaki's 160 mm rear tire. The KTM has a longer wheelbase (1475 mm) compared to the Kawasaki's 1410 mm wheelbase. The seat height of the KTM is also higher at 825 mm compared to the Kawasaki's 790 mm seat height. However, the Kawasaki has a larger fuel tank capacity of 15 liters compared to the KTM's 14 liters.
In terms of strengths, the KTM 790 Duke 2018 offers a high-revving engine with powerful acceleration, an optimized chassis for sporty riding, a fantastic sound even with the stock exhaust, many electronic tricks and functions, and a comfortable seating position.

On the other hand, the Kawasaki Z650 2017 offers a smooth power delivery, a sporty chassis, compact dimensions, and a negative display.
In terms of weaknesses, the KTM 790 Duke 2018 has a difficult handling at low revs, is not suitable for city traffic, and has complicated switches on the handlebar. Additionally, there have been reports of oil leaks in the engine block of many 790 Dukes.
The Kawasaki Z650 2017's weakness is that it may be a bit too small for taller riders.
Overall, the KTM 790 Duke 2018 offers more power, advanced features, and a sportier riding experience compared to the Kawasaki Z650 2017. However, the Kawasaki may be more suitable for riders who prioritize a smooth power delivery and compact dimensions.

A KTM 790 Duke L é uma moto naked absolutamente desportiva com um elevado fator de diversão. Se um condutor principiante consegue lidar com ela depende muito da sua personalidade e comportamento de condução. Existem certamente motos mais adequadas para a aprendizagem, mas os caçadores de raios desportivos dificilmente ficarão satisfeitos com outra coisa. A 790 Duke L também não é muito entusiasta dos passeios quotidianos na cidade. Na estrada rural, no entanto, é uma explosão, mesmo com apenas 48 cv. Simplesmente uma moto divertida como está escrito no livro.

A Kawasaki Z 650 é a ponta da classe média para os pequenos condutores masculinos e femininos. Com as suas dimensões compactas, provavelmente não se sentirá confortável como um gigante. No entanto, as sensações reconfortantes vêm do motor, que se delicia com uma tração muito suave. Do lado do chassis, foi escolhida uma configuração apertada típica da Kawasaki, que encontra um ótimo compromisso na utilização diária. O ecrã negativo é muito fácil de ler e faz lembrar a sua antecessora, a ER-6n - muito bonito!

There are a few key differences between a KTM 790 Duke 2018 and a Kawasaki Z650 2017. In terms of price, the actual average price of a KTM 790 Duke 2018 is about 29% higher. A KTM 790 Duke 2018 experiences a loss of 720 EUR in one year and 1 120 EUR in two years of ownership. This is offset by a loss of 420 EUR and 640 EUR for a Kawasaki Z650 2017. Compared to Kawasaki Z650 2017 there are more KTM 790 Duke 2018 bikes available on the 1000PS.de Marketplace, specifically 24 compared to 11. It takes less time to sell a KTM 790 Duke with 58 days compared to 76 days for a Kawasaki Z650.
